 Just found a wonderful new challenge, Can You Handle the Pressure.  It's hosted by the very talented duo,  Darlene and Diane, and it's all about embossing folders.   I used my favorite embossing folder...it's a Hobby Lobby brand and looks like a Double Wedding Ring Quilt pattern.  The florals are Dahlias by Papertrey Ink, and the sentiment is a well-loved and, sadly retired, Verve stamp.

Layered Bouquet Encouragement Cards


 The background panels of these floral encouragement cards were created using a MFT stencil and a rainbow of Papertrey Ink  colors.  The florals are Pink Fresh Studio's Layered Bouquet.  The insides are stamped with some of my favorite scriptures.
